CODE BLOG
12.1K subscribers
5.14K photos
36 videos
99 files
2.92K links
IT юмор, обучающие видео и многое другое.

YouTube: https://youtube.com/codeblog
VK: https://vk.com/codeblog
Чат: @codeblog_chat

По всем вопросам: @p_shvanov

Ресурс включён в перечень Роскомнадзора: https://www.gosuslugi.ru/snet/67c04851241cbc1f487e5054
加入频道
Масштабный проект для разработчиков по созданию сквозного HR-продукта в Газпром Нефть https://clck.ru/etAHy


💸 Роли и вознаграждение за проект на руки (6 месяцев, полная занятость):
- FullStack (Teamlead) - 2 340 000 ₽
- BackEnd developer- 1 620 000 ₽
- FrontEnd developer- 1 500 000 ₽

🔺О проекте:
ПАО Газпром нефть формирует продуктовую команду для разработки собственного ИТ-продукта, который обеспечит единый интерфейс для управления структурой, должностями, ролями и соответствующими бизнес-процессами, интеграцию с информационными системами SAP, 1C, Jira и др. и формирование аналитической отчетности. Необходимо разработать следующий релиз ИТ-продукта на основе существующего MVP.

🔺Наш стек: C#, Net Core 3.1, PostgresPro Enterprise, MSSQL, Linux, React, TypeScript, CSS

🔺 Чем предстоит заниматься:
- Проанализировать бэклог и детализировать задачи, распределив ответственность между тремя ролями
- Определить способы интеграции со смежными информационными системами и построения взаимодействия фронтенд- и бэкенд-частей решения
- Выполнить итеративные циклы разработки и тестирования в формате двухнедельных спринтов
- Разработать модульные и интеграционные тесты для разработанных компонентов

🔺 Наши ожидания от кандидатов:
- Опыт коммерческой разработки от 3-х лет
- Знания языков C# и фреймворка .Net Core 3.1, баз данных PostgresPro Enterprise и MS SQL
- Знание архитектуры и подходов к реализации интеграций со сторонними системами, ручного тестирования и разработки автотестов
- Глубокое понимание работы с Git и Git-flow

🔺 Почему это интересно:
- Долгосрочный проект и стабильные выплаты
- Задачи со звездочкой, которые интересно решать
- Возможность познакомиться с бизнес-командой одной из крупнейших компаний страны

Оформление: Самозанятый/физ лицо/ИП
Формат: гибридный, с присутствием в офисе 2–3 дня в неделю (офисы расположены 20 городах России)

Проект размещен на платформе "Профессионалы 4.0", где каждый день появляются интересные проекты
Подробное описание проекта и ролей можно посмотреть здесь https://clck.ru/etAHy

Вопросы задать Ирине @irinagiachene
Таким можно и похвастаться

#ithumor
DevOps

1. DevOps – начало работы в кластере Kubernetes
2. DevSecOps. Общее погружение
3. DevOps на пальцах
4. SecOps. Защита кластера
5. DevSec. Встраивание ИБ в конвейер разработки
6. DevSecOps. Process edition
7. Что такое Audit Policy?
8. Зачем GitOps в Enterprise?
9. Управление секретами: основы
10. Persistent данные и резервное копирование в кластере

#video

https://www.youtube.com/watch?v=fQeqCqEDTu0&list=PLVb9C2cD47ixblei1oBbES3dEMr9_PXCK&ab_channel=%D0%98%D0%BD%D1%84%D0%BE%D1%81%D0%B8%D1%81%D1%82%D0%B5%D0%BC%D1%8B%D0%94%D0%B6%D0%B5%D1%82
На вебинаре расскажем, как бэкенд-разработчику выстроить карьерный план, какие скилы стоит развивать, чтобы вырасти в мидл-разработчика, и что делать, если план пошёл по незапланированному пути.

19 апреля 19:00
Зарегистрироваться
Чел, который отвечает за погоду явно тянет все до дедлайна

#ithumor
Нейронная сеть C#

1. Простая нейросеть.
2. Алгоритм обратного распространения ошибки
3. Обучение по Dataset.
4. Компьютерное зрение и распознавание образов нейронной сетью
5. Информационная система медицинской организации

#video #csharp

https://www.youtube.com/watch?v=woohvQE73AI&list=PLIIXgDT0bKw7VnfMl5wWW_kjmmCrHjfvb&ab_channel=CODEBLOG
Пишешь код на C# и хочешь вырасти до мидла или сеньора?
Освой продвинутые навыки на открытом вебинаре в OTUS.

👉 Тема вебинара: «Дженерики, их реализация и ограничения».

💪 Мы рассмотрим обобщенные типы и методы, причины появления, их использование, обсудим ограничения обобщений и варианты наследования обобщенных типов.

📌 Demo-занятие пройдет в рамках онлайн-курса «C# Developer. Professional» от OTUS.
Это шанс познакомиться с преподавателем и оценить качество материалов.

👉 Пройди вступительный тест, чтобы записаться на мероприятие https://otus.pw/6vl1/
В итоге не уложился в сроки и тебя уволили

#ithumor
Курсы по кибербезопасности с нуля до аналитика DevSecOps

1. Курсы по кибербезопасности с нуля до аналитика DevSecOps. Часть 1
2. Курсы по кибербезопасности с нуля до аналитика DevSecOps. Часть 2
3. Курсы по кибербезопасности с нуля до аналитика DevSecOps. Часть 3
4. Курсы по кибербезопасности с нуля до аналитика DevSecOps. Часть 4
5. Курсы по кибербезопасности с нуля до аналитика DevSecOps. Часть 5
6. Курсы по кибербезопасности с нуля до аналитика DevSecOps. Часть 6
7. Курсы по кибербезопасности с нуля до аналитика DevSecOps. Часть 7

#video #security

https://www.youtube.com/watch?v=_HcACxBsBLg&list=PLMiVLClzZDbTWSsxWfVvrvdyHgSa7Wvaw&ab_channel=CiscoNeSlabo%2FSEDICOMMTV
Многие уже привыкли к аутентификации через Face ID или Touch ID. Все это — биометрические технологии, способные распознавать лицо, отпечатки пальцев и даже походку человека. Какие еще возможности дает биометрия и насколько это безопасно, рассказывает шеф-редактор «Кода» Михаил Полянин в новом выпуске подкаста Газпромбанка «ZIP. Архив техногенного мира».

Слушайте и делитесь > https://vk.cc/ccRaXA
Используем все, лишь бы работало

#ithumor
Тестировщик с нуля. Курс с нуля до Junior QA

1. Жизненный Цикл ПО
2. Методологии разработки ПО (Scrum Waterfall)
3. Тестирование требований
4. Виды тестирования
5. Техники тест дизайна Классы эквивалентности и граничные значения
6. Составление баг репортов
7. Тестировщик по / как стать тестировщиком с нуля / курс QA

#video #qa

https://www.youtube.com/watch?v=hCo8cMHH4XA&list=PLZqgWWF4O-zjU4q66Cd2PjDa44h07dzTS&ab_channel=%D0%9B%D1%91%D1%88%D0%B0%D0%9C%D0%B0%D1%80%D1%88%D0%B0%D0%BB
Конечно...

#ithumor
Пишем свой мессенджер для Android на Kotlin.

1. Подготовка проекта.
2. Создаем боковое меню Material Drawer.
3. Заполняем боковое меню.
4. Добавляем фрагменты.
5. Рефакторинг кода.
6. Заполняем фрагмент настроек.
7. Добавляем Options menu с иконками.
8. Создаем окно регистрации по номеру телефона.
9. Рефакторинг кода. Работаем с Лямбда выражениями.
10. Подключение к Firebase.

#video #android #kotlin

https://www.youtube.com/watch?v=iO8FMBWKO3Y&list=PLY8G5DMG6TiOBq7OWFPWF2Um3FRB5s2ke&index=66&ab_channel=%D0%9C%D0%BE%D0%B1%D0%B8%D0%BB%D1%8C%D0%BD%D1%8B%D0%B9%D1%80%D0%B0%D0%B7%D1%80%D0%B0%D0%B1%D0%BE%D1%82%D1%87%D0%B8%D0%BA
В какой-то части это должно сработать

#ithumor
Быстрые курсы

1. Express JS Быстрый Курс
2. NestJS Быстрый Курс. Express на максималках
3. Git и GitHub Курс Для Новичков
4. NextJS Быстрый Курс - SSR на React JS 2020
5. TypeScript 2020. Быстрый Курс за 70 минут
6. Node JS - Быстрый Курс за 1 час (Все Включено!)
7. React JS Быстрый Курс 2020
8. Angular - Быстрый курс за 60 минут
9. Vue JS - Быстрый курс за 50 минут (Все Включено!)

#video #js

https://www.youtube.com/watch?v=xJZa2_aldDs&list=PLqKQF2ojwm3lrzkYrqnxh6qywB99dCyCt&ab_channel=%D0%92%D0%BB%D0%B0%D0%B4%D0%B8%D0%BB%D0%B5%D0%BD%D0%9C%D0%B8%D0%BD%D0%B8%D0%BD
Квитанции сами себя не оплатят

#ithumor
Практический курс по SQL для начинающих

1 Введение в PostgreSQL
2 Базовые SELECT запросы
3 Соединения (JOIN)
4 Подзапросы в SQL
5 DDL: создание БД, таблиц и их модификация
6 Проектирование и нормализация Базы Данных (БД)
7 Представления в SQL
8 Логика с CASE и COALESCE в SQL
9 Функции SQL
10 Функции pl/pgSQL

#video #sql

https://www.youtube.com/watch?v=HVQNxdI6fqY&list=PLBheEHDcG7-k1Y_Uy04Dj2ylWhcfSfqoF&ab_channel=EngineerSpock-IT%26%D0%BF%D1%80%D0%BE%D0%B3%D1%80%D0%B0%D0%BC%D0%BC%D0%B8%D1%80%D0%BE%D0%B2%D0%B0%D0%BD%D0%B8%D0%B5
Просто они используют компьютеры на AMD

#ithumor
Учим Rust вместе

1. Hello World
2. Guessing Game
3. переменные и типы данных
4. функции и контроль выполнения программы
5. разбор задач
6. владение
7. заимствование и слайсы
8. структуры и методы
9. перечислимые типы
10. пакеты и модули

#video #rust

https://www.youtube.com/watch?v=YNWu9V-V5c4&list=PLXhUgKrQD6UoggzaDTQ1luq3XMpYboMTM&ab_channel=%D0%97%D0%B0%D0%BF%D0%B8%D1%81%D0%BA%D0%B8%D0%BF%D1%80%D0%BE%D0%B3%D1%80%D0%B0%D0%BC%D0%BC%D0%B8%D1%81%D1%82%D0%B0